The TE Connectivity Metal film precision MELF resistor from the AEC-Q200 qualified offers exemplary performance and reliability for demanding applications. Designed with a surface mounted device (SMD) structure, it boasts low temperature coefficients and high stability, making it ideal for critical automotive, industrial, and telecommunication systems. It is lead-free and RoHS compliant, delivering robust protection against humidity and environmental factors. With variations in power ratings and sizes, this resistor meets diverse operational needs while ensuring optimal energy efficiency. Its thin-film technology and tight tolerance support precise measurements for sensitive electronic circuits, establishing it as a go-to choice for engineers seeking high quality components.

AEC Q200 qualification ensures compliance with automotive standards

SMD enabled construction facilitates easy integration into modern circuit designs

Improved coating offers enhanced protection against moisture ingress

Low temperature coefficient results in minimal resistance variation across temperature fluctuations

Lead free and RoHS compliant design upholds environmental responsibilities

Robust electrical characteristics support high stability in diverse applications

Wide resistance range caters to various design specifications

Optimised for consistent performance in both standard and high power modes
